How Often Should a Restaurant Post on Social Media?
Three to five Instagram Reels per week, one to three Stories per day, and one to two TikToks per week is the sweet spot for most restaurants. Consistency beats frequency - posting steadily for six months outperforms posting daily for one.
The cadence that actually works
Instagram's algorithm rewards consistency more than raw volume. An account posting 3 Reels per week every week for 6 months will out-grow one posting 10 Reels one week and zero the next. Stories should be daily (1-3 per day) because they signal the algorithm that your account is active.
TikTok rewards posting volume more aggressively - 1-2 per week is a floor, 3-5 is better if you can. Facebook can ride on cross-posted Instagram content; native Facebook posting is now largely vestigial for restaurants.
How to make it sustainable
The number-one reason restaurants stop posting is that it falls on one overworked owner. The fix: assign social to a specific person (often the GM or a part-time content creator), batch content weekly, and never post live unless you want to. Block 60 minutes on Monday to shoot 5-7 short clips. Edit them on Tuesday. Schedule them out across the week using Meta's built-in scheduler or a tool like Later.

Step-by-step
- 01Pick a sustainable cadence you can hit every week without fail. Start with 3 Reels + daily Stories.
- 02Designate one person as the owner of social. Not 'whoever has time.'
- 03Batch shoot: 60 minutes per week, 6-10 clips at a time.
- 04Schedule posts via Meta Business Suite (free) for the week.
- 05Track posts that perform 2x your account average. Make more of those.
Common mistakes
- ×Posting whenever you remember. Erratic posting hurts reach more than a lower cadence.
- ×Trying to keep up with daily Reels alone. Burns out the owner and stops within a month.
- ×Posting the same content across all platforms. Each platform has different formats - resize and reformat.
- ×Skipping Stories because they 'disappear.' Stories are where regulars hang out.
